Every month Feeding Pets of the Homeless® is able to report to the general public and our supporters the amount in pounds and the fair market value of donations you and others have collected.

Monthly reports not only increase your chances of winning the drawings for prizes, but assist us in reporting how much food is donated and distributed.

Using the Donation Site Report to increase your chances in the quarterly drawing for a Starbucks gift card! Reports are due each quarter by Jan 5, April 5, July 5, and Oct 5. Monthly reports increase your chances of winning the drawings for prizes.

This form does not serve as a receipt for these contributions, but is intended for our internal record keeping purposes only.

    Hi, my name is Sammy.I’m a 5-year-old German Shepherd mix living with my mom in a shed without utilities. We are currently experiencing homelessness, but we have each other. My mom is my best friend, and I do my best to protect her. My favorite things are going to the park and getting belly rubs.One day during a walk, I got away from my mom and was hit by a car.She was terrified she was going to lose me.After searching for help, she found Feeding Pets of the Homeless. She completed an application, was connected with a case manager, and I was approved for veterinary care.At the clinic, the veterinarian performed X-rays and blood work. The results showed I had a fractured femur and would need surgery to repair it.My mom was relieved to know there was a way to help me.The doctor successfully repaired my leg, and I was sent back to her with pain medication and antibiotics to recover. Every day I am getting a little stronger, and I look forward to the day I can run and play again.Feeding Pets of the Homeless contributed $2,000 toward my care.📩 A message from my mom:"I just wanted to thank you and your organization for all the help you provided. I can't express how grateful I am. He's all I've got, and it's a blessing to know that there are such kindhearted people who care and go out of their way to help people like myself who are stuck in this kind of situation.
